Dear friends.
Battushig in the book has written not correctly. I translated with experts an inscription in the bottom of a sign - there is written "The Best (shot) marksman". This sign means is the first type of a sign on marksmen. The sign rarity speaks that in the thirties there was a decree forbidding carrying of signs similar to the Soviet awards. Such signs were subject to withdrawal.

Type 1 (two piece riveted construction)
Low = 13 High = 242
Type 2 (one piece construction)
Low = 420 High = ?
======================
I believe the above might need to be updated:
- B's book shows 115 as a type 2; 420 would rather then be put as highest sighted
- Recently 114 was on sale on eBay and this was a type 1
